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Whitton (London) to Honley start from as little as £34.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Whitton (London) to Honley start from £75.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Whitton (London) to Honley are available for £171.30 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Everything you need to know about Whitton (London) Station

Discover The Charm of Whitton (London) Train Station

Nestled in the suburban tranquility of the London Borough of Richmond upon Thames, Whitton (London) train station is a cozy transit point that acts as a gateway to the bustling energy of central London and beyond. Ideal for commuters and casual travelers alike, the station is situated on the Hounslow Loop Line, providing convenient access to numerous destinations.

Modern Facilities at Whitton (London) Train Station

Whitton (London) station is designed to cater to a diverse range of passengers. It provides essential facilities including ticket machines, with accessible options available for those travelling with a Disabled Persons Railcard. The ticket office is operational from early morning until late on weekdays and slightly adjusted hours over the weekend, ensuring passengers can purchase or collect tickets at their convenience. For those who prefer a cashless experience, smartcard validators are available to streamline your journey.

Accessibility is a notable feature at Whitton (London). The station proudly offers step-free access to all platforms, making travel seamless for individuals with mobility challenges. Accessible toilets are available adjacent to the ticket office, however, general seating areas and waiting rooms are not present at the station. Although staff help isn't available, customer help points and assistance from the train guard are accessible for travelers requiring additional support.

Your Journey Beyond Whitton Station

For those planning onward travel from Whitton, the station is well-connected with various transport modes. Bus services facilitate easy transit to local destinations such as Hounslow, Twickenham, and Feltham, with stops conveniently located on High Street. While there are no dedicated cycle hire facilities, the station does offer ample bicycle storage with 32 spaces right at the booking hall entrance.

Everything you need to know about Honley Station

Discovering Honley Train Station

Nestled in the scenic heart of West Yorkshire, Honley Train Station is a quaint spot that caters to both locals and visitors eager to explore the region's natural beauty. While the railway station itself is modest, it connects to numerous vibrant destinations across the UK. Whether you're setting off to explore the rugged landscapes of Yorkshire or heading into the bustling city life, Honley Station serves as a charming starting point for your travels.

Honley Station Facilities

When planning a journey from Honley, it's important to be aware of the station's facilities. While the station does not have a staffed ticket office, it does provide ticket machines for your convenience, including options for collecting tickets purchased online. Moreover, the machines are equipped with accessible features, making it easier for everyone to use.

The absence of specific amenities at Honley, such as shops, restrooms, or seating areas, means it's wise to arrive prepared. However, if you find yourself in need of assistance, there are help points available on the platform, ensuring you can reach staff via their helpline if needed. Keep in mind, there is no luggage storage or CCTV on site, so plan accordingly.

Access and Support Services

Accessibility can be a challenge as Honley Station is categorized as a Category C station with no step-free access. Be prepared to navigate 27 steps to reach the platform. For those who might require assistance, conductors are available on trains to offer help using boarding ramps. Travellers are encouraged to book assistance up to 2 hours before their planned departure through the Passenger Assist service.

Parking, cycling facilities, and additional accessible services such as taxis or spaces for impaired mobility are not available here, so plan your journey accordingly.

Connections and Transfers

Honley's transportation connections make planning your onward journey straightforward. A rail replacement service is available outside the station entrance, and taxis can be easily arranged through services like CAB4YOU. Additionally, a convenient bus stop nearby allows you to access local bus services using the Busline at 0871 200 2233.
